A contingent of NWAG members of the association of 16mm modellers hopped across the north pennines to the Eden valley to visit this railway. The line is a double circuit, a variety of engines are seen including the ANLR's Accucraft Caradoc, a Roundhouse Jack and a Roundhouse Lady Anne.
